Dr. Alena Bartonova’s core research area is environmental exposure assessment. Her work rests on high levels of interdisciplinary collaboration and often supports science use for policies. She is interested in environmental/air quality assessment methods combining results from monitoring and diverse measurement technologies (including low-cost sensors) with models, resulting in a basis for health impact assessment, and in development of methods for practical use.
Alena has a MSc and a RNDr degree in Probability and Mathematical Statistics from the Faculty of Mathematics and Physics, Charles University, Prague, CZ, and PhD in Environmental Sciences from the Faculty of Science of the same University. She started at NILU as a post doc 1987-1990, when she was studying environmental epidemiology methods and the relationship between air pollution and material damage.
Alena has served in several positions of trust nationally and internationally, including as in expert groups within the fifth and seventh Framework Programs for research of the EU, and as a member of SCHER 2013-2016. She has coordinated or co-coordinated several EU-co-funded research and innovation projects. Alena serves as Research Director – coordinator for EU research and Manager, European Topic Center for human health and environment.

Deployment and testing of lower-cost ambient air quality sensor systems in urban environment (sensEURcity )
The ‘sensEURcity’ project was launched because measurements from cheaper (low cost) air quality sensors are still too unreliable and data quality is insufficiently known. With this project, the Directorate-General of the European Joint Research Centre (DG JRC), with funding from the Directorate-General for Environment, aims to help evaluate the performance and potential of low-cost sensor systems for air quality and make comparisons with conventional measurement methods.
